uPVC construction materials are strong and require minimal maintenance. It is easy to maintain and does not shrink or rot. It also offers good insulation and helps reduce costs for energy.

UPVC door issues like a stuck handle or misaligned pivots might require professional repairs. These issues must be addressed quickly to ensure the security, functionality, and aesthetic appeal of your home.

Window repairs using UPVC

Upvc windows are a favorite choice for homeowners because they are durable, energy efficient, and require little maintenance. But, just like any other window type, uPVC windows can experience problems in time. Fortunately professional repair services are able to address these issues and restore the function of the window.

UPVC window repair can include replacing broken frames, sills, and sashes. They may also include replacing cracked or damaged glass. These repair services will ensure that your UPVC window is energy-efficient and secure. You can also reduce your energy bills by reducing drafts inside your house.

One of the most common problems with uPVC windows is condensation that forms on the surface. This issue is usually caused by airflow and temperature difference between the outdoor and indoor environment. There are a variety of factors that can cause this issue, such as the accumulation of dirt and debris on the window tracks or an improper alignment of the window sash. No matter what the cause the issue can be difficult to solve, especially during colder weather.

Another common problem with UPVC windows is leaks. These leaks are typically caused by worn-out hardware, sashes that are not aligned properly, or damaged seals. It is essential to address these problems as soon as you can to avoid water damage and other complications. Fortunately, a professional UPVC repair services can diagnose the issue and fix it fast and easily.

UPVC windows may also develop cracks and dents. Minor damage to the frame or beading may be repaired, while major damage requires a replacement. Luckily, UPVC repair services can make this process as simple and affordable as it can be.

uPVC (Unplasticised Polyvinyl Chloride) is the most sought-after material used in windows, doors and roofline products. It is low-maintenance, comes in a variety of colors and styles, and is easy to clean. Upvc windows and doors are extremely durable and will last for many years to come, allowing you to enjoy the advantages of energy efficiency as well as comfort and security.

The low maintenance required by uPVC is a huge benefit, since it is not subject to the same problems like other materials, such as wood or aluminium. Upvc windows and doors are resistant to mould, rust chemical rot, and they do not fade or warp in hot weather. They are also impervious, and will not swell like timber or metal frames. This means they don't need painting, and all you will need to do is wipe them down with a damp sponge when necessary.

A common issue uPVC owners face is that their double-glazed becomes difficult to open or close. Extreme temperature fluctuations can cause the frames' expansion and contraction, causing them to "stick". If you experience this issue, try oiling the mechanisms and hinges or adjusting the handles. If this doesn't help, contact the company you purchased your uPVC from - they may offer to repair it under warranty.

Another common issue with uPVC windows is that they get misted and this can be extremely frustrating. The misty windows are usually the result of a break in the integrity of the seal that allows humidity to gain access to the glass panes. Totalseal can easily solve this issue.

UPVC door repairs

uPVC front doors are a popular type of door used in homes. They are less expensive than composite doors, and offer a higher level of security. However, as with all kinds of doors, they are susceptible to damage and require maintenance. It can be anything from replacing a broken lock to repairing the entire door. If your uPVC door is showing signs of wear and tear it is essential to have the repairs done as soon as you can. This will ensure that your home stays secure and that the door is easy to open and shut.

The majority of uPVC door issues can be fixed easily, especially if you have the right tools and materials. If your uPVC has a small dent or a hole, you could fix it with a simple filler like wood putty (auto body repair material). This will restore the original shape and condition of the panel. However, if the damage is more significant or complex, it's recommended to consult an expert uPVC repair service for your door.

Another common uPVC door issue is the handle not locking properly. This is usually due to the uPVC door hinges becoming misaligned over time. To prevent this from happening, you should apply a lubricant to keep the hinges and rollers running smoothly. A silicon-based lubricant is best because it doesn't retain dirt and debris that can cause the hinges to become misaligned.

In addition to uPVC hinges for doors It's also a good idea to lubricate the multi-point locks on your uPVC doors. It's crucial that your uPVC door is locked properly since most burglaries happen through the front doors. A professional uPVC locksmith can usually fix any malfunctioning locking mechanism without damaging your current doors and frames.

Window lock repair

Window locks play an essential function in preventing unauthorised access to your home. They also improve the security and energy efficiency of your home. It is therefore crucial to keep them in good working order and to prevent them from becoming damaged. Repair services can address any issues with your windows such as broken locks, stuck handles, and the wrongly aligned pivots.

The best uPVC windows are designed to last for many years however, they require regular maintenance and cleaning to keep them in good shape. You can easily clean them using a mixture of water and vinegar. This method removes dirt, dust, and grime off the surfaces of the windows, without damaging it.
